Wind Power by State. The state leading the charge in wind power capacity is Texas. As of 2021, the state has installed almost 36 gigawatts of wind energy, nearly three times the capacity for wind power generation as Iowa, the second leading state in cumulative wind power capacity. However, Iowa takes advantage of the wind speed in the area.

How Wind Power Works

The cost of utility-scale wind power has come down dramatically in the last two decades due to technological and design advancements in turbine production and installation. In the early 1980s, wind power cost about 30 cents per kWh. In 2006, wind power costs as little as 3 to 5 cents per kWh where wind is especially abundant.

What are the different types of wind power?

There are two main types of wind power: onshore and offshore. The first one refers to the energy that is generated by wind turbines located on land and driven by the natural movement of air. Offshore wind energy is obtained by taking advantage of the force of the wind that flows on high seas.

How does a wind generator work?

The energy in the wind turns the blades that are connected to the main shaft, which turns and spins a second shaft, which spins a generator to create electricity. – A machine that is used to make electricity. When the generator head is turned, this energy is converted to electrical energy.

How do energy companies make electricity from wind?

In order to make electricity from wind, energy companies use large windmills called wind turbines. They are called this because they use turbine generators to generate the electricity. In order to create a lot of energy capable of powering thousands of homes, energy companies build large wind farms with lots of wind turbines.
